What Causes Disproportional Size Of Head With Body?

Hello. I am 19 years old and a year ago I noticed that my head is disproportional (smaller) with my body. But 2 years ago, It was proportional with my body. So is there something wrong with my growth hormones as my body grew taller but my head didnt grow?

There are different phases in the growth cycle of our body specially the growth spurt is very unique. In this period of two years mostly 16-19 years of age in males, the body grows at a brisk pace and in this phase the body symmetry can be unpredictable.

Many people get really skinny during this phase ..many may get sudden weight gain . some may get real tall some may not change much, some may feel there is a disturbed symmetry like you felt about your head.

Head usually grows when the growth of body stops, or in simple words when you stop getting tall with that super speed then head starts to get heavy , this is the time when body also starts to recover some weight.

It is also an established fact that when growth plates have met and one is not growing much any more the growth hormone makes head and fingers a bit larger even without acromegaly which is extreme excess of growth hormones.

In my opinion your dysproportionality was a physiological normal process you probably noted that because you must have lost weight and head bulk , after you reached your destination height or near it, the bulk of face and cheeks started to turn back to normal and every thing got in symmetry yet again.

There does not seem to be any hormonal imbalance everything should be fine you don't have to panic and get anxious about it.
